What is the Utah State Employees' Charitable Fund Pledge and Payroll Deduction Form?
The Utah State Employees' Charitable Fund Pledge Form acts as a mechanism for state employees to contribute to charitable organizations through payroll deductions. This form simplifies the process, allowing employees to spread their charitable donations throughout the year via the Utah payroll deduction form.
By utilizing this form, Utah state employees can seamlessly support their chosen charities, ensuring their contributions are automated directly from their paychecks.

Who is eligible to fill out the Utah State Employees' Charitable Fund Pledge and Payroll Deduction Form?
All current Utah state employees are eligible to complete this form to authorize charitable contributions through payroll deductions.
What is the deadline for submitting the form?
The completed form should be submitted prior to the end of the calendar year to ensure deductions begin in January of the next year.

Can I change my donation amount after submission?
Yes, if you wish to change your donation amount, you can fill out a new form and submit it according to your state agency’s procedures.
